Leadership development can set you apart from your peers so you can advance your career. This podcast is hosted by Stephen McLain, a U.S. Army-Retired Finance Officer. After retirement, Stephen transitioned to working as a Team Member and Business Consultant in Corporate Finance and Accounting. In the Finance and Accounting professions, we tend to have great technical expertise, but there is a leadership skills gap. This podcast will be dedicated to leadership development for Finance and Accounting professionals, where we will focus on leadership topics such as providing a purpose for our team, building trust, improving communication, and developing our team.
